数字识别,神经网络工作不正常
Numbers recognition, neural net not working properly
我正在做一个OCR项目,至少尝试识别数字。我有两层的汉明神经网络。如果它能解决问题,我会在这里发布消息来源。问题是这个网络不能正常工作,结果总是1和7。顺便说一句,当将标准图像的大小更改为10x10像素时,它也不起作用,但现在的数字是3和0。所以,如果有人能帮我解决这个问题,我将不胜感激,也许总的来说有什么事情会导致这个问题。当然,如果需要的话,我可以发布我的源代码。我现在正在比较非常相似的图片,这就是为什么这个问题让我感到惊讶。
最近我不得不在Matlab中实现同样的东西,我得到了大约78%的准确率。我使用了40x40的图像,并根据每个像素周围3x3到15x15框的平均值构建了特征向量。也许图像尺寸太小是问题所在?
相关文章:
- C++中的memset函数工作不正常
- 通用线程池类工作不正常
- 名为DLL的C++windows服务程序工作不正常
- C++-循环中的If语句工作不正常
- While循环和if/else语句工作不正常
- C++:最大数组值函数工作不正常
- 工会工作不正常
- 为什么这个循环运行不可见的代码?工作不正常
- C++STL映射键和值工作不正常
- c++文件指针工作不正常
- do while循环工作不正常
- qdbusxml2cpp工作不正常
- 缓存未命中似乎工作不正常
- 线程工作不正常
- 循环工作不正常
- 构造函数工作不正常
- IOCTL_DISK_GET_DRIVE_LAYOUT_EX工作不正常
- C++if/else-if语句工作不正常
- 面部和眼睛检测工作不正常
- Qt-RegExp工作不正常